Frontend-разработка – это создание визуальной части веб-приложений, с которой взаимодействуют пользователи. Каждый сайт, который вы посещаете, каждая кнопка, на которую нажимаете, каждая анимация, которую видите – все это работа frontend-разработчиков. В условиях острой нехватки квалифицированных специалистов особую ценность приобретает качественное обучение программистов в Москве – Хекслет Колледж предлагает комплексную подготовку frontend-разработчиков по специальности «Информационные системы и программирование» с акцентом на современные веб-технологии и гарантированной практикой в IT-компаниях.
Что такое frontend-разработка
Frontend – это лицо любого веб-проекта. Разработчик отвечает за то, как выглядит сайт, насколько он удобен, как быстро загружается и насколько приятно с ним взаимодействовать. Это идеальная профессия для тех, кто хочет совместить техническую экспертизу с творческим подходом.
Frontend-разработчик создает:
Технологический стек frontend-разработчика
HTML и CSS – основа основ
HTML структурирует контент, CSS отвечает за визуальное оформление. Современный frontend требует глубокого понимания семантической верстки, флексбоксов, гридов, анимаций и препроцессоров (SASS, LESS).
JavaScript – язык интерактивности
Ключевой навык любого frontend-разработчика. От базового синтаксиса до продвинутых концепций: замыкания, промисы, async/await, работа с DOM, события, AJAX-запросы.
Фреймворки и библиотеки
React – самая популярная библиотека для создания пользовательских интерфейсов. Vue.js – прогрессивный фреймворк с низким порогом входа. Angular – мощное решение для enterprise-проектов. Знание хотя бы одного фреймворка обязательно для современного разработчика.
Инструменты разработки
Git для контроля версий, Webpack для сборки проектов, npm/yarn для управления зависимостями, Chrome DevTools для отладки, Figma для работы с макетами.
Дополнительные технологии
TypeScript для типизации JavaScript-кода, GraphQL для работы с API, тестирование с Jest, State management с Redux или MobX.
Обучение frontend-разработке в колледже
Профессиональное образование дает системный подход к изучению frontend-технологий:
Первый год – фундамент
Основы программирования, алгоритмы и структуры данных, базовая верстка, основы JavaScript. Параллельно изучаются общеобразовательные предметы для тех, кто поступил после 9 класса.
Второй год – погружение в специальность
Углубленное изучение JavaScript, работа с фреймворками, создание первых полноценных проектов, основы UX/UI дизайна, работа с API.
Третий год – специализация и практика
Продвинутые техники разработки, оптимизация производительности, работа в команде над реальными проектами, стажировка в IT-компаниях.
Практические проекты и портфолио
В процессе обучения студенты создают:
Лендинги и корпоративные сайты
От простых одностраничников до многостраничных сайтов с адаптивной версткой и анимациями.
Интерактивные веб-приложения
ToDo-листы, калькуляторы, игры – проекты, демонстрирующие навыки работы с JavaScript.
SPA на современных фреймворках
Интернет-магазины, социальные сети, CRM-системы – полноценные приложения с роутингом, авторизацией, работой с данными.
Дипломный проект
Комплексное веб-приложение, решающее реальную бизнес-задачу. Часто выполняется по заказу компании-партнера.
Карьерный путь и зарплаты
Junior Frontend Developer (0-1 год)
Зарплата: 70 000 – 90 000 рублей в Москве Задачи: верстка по макетам, простые JavaScript-задачи, исправление багов, работа под руководством старших коллег.
Middle Frontend Developer (1-3 года)
Зарплата: 140 000 – 200 000 рублей Самостоятельная разработка компонентов, участие в проектировании архитектуры, менторинг джуниоров, работа с современным стеком.
Senior Frontend Developer (3+ лет)
Зарплата: от 200 000 рублей Проектирование архитектуры фронтенда, выбор технологического стека, оптимизация производительности, техническое лидерство.
Альтернативные пути развития:
• Team Lead – управление командой разработчиков
• Frontend Architect – проектирование сложных систем
• Fullstack Developer – расширение компетенций на backend
• Переход в смежные области: UX/UI дизайн, продакт-менеджмент
Преимущества обучения в IT-колледже
Системность знаний В отличие от краткосрочных курсов, колледж дает фундаментальное образование. Вы изучаете не только frontend, но и основы backend-разработки, базы данных, алгоритмы – это делает вас более ценным специалистом.
Время на освоение 3 года обучения позволяют глубоко погрузиться в профессию, попробовать разные технологии, найти свою специализацию.
Практика в реальных компаниях Стажировки дают бесценный опыт работы в команде, знакомство с процессами разработки, возможность получить оффер еще до выпуска.
Диплом государственного образца Официальный документ об образовании важен для многих работодателей, особенно в корпоративном секторе.
Отсрочка от армии Для юношей – возможность получить профессию до службы в армии.
Заключение
Frontend-разработка – это входная точка в мир программирования с отличными карьерными перспективами. Визуальные результаты работы, востребованность на рынке, высокие зарплаты и возможность удаленной работы делают эту профессию одной из самых привлекательных в IT.
Качественное обучение в IT-колледже, особенно в таком технологичном городе как Москва, дает конкурентные преимущества: системные знания, практический опыт, профессиональные связи. Инвестируя 3 года в образование, вы получаете профессию на всю жизнь с постоянными возможностями для роста и развития.